Understanding the Science of Pain:


Pain is a complex sensation that involves a multitude of physiological and psychological factors. Physiotherapists rely on a thorough understanding of pain mechanisms to provide effective care. Here's a brief overview of the science of pain:

  1. Pain Perception: Pain begins with the activation of specialized nerve fibers called nociceptors. These receptors transmit signals to the brain when they detect potential tissue damage. Once the brain receives these signals, it interprets them as pain.

  2. Types of Pain: There are two primary types of pain – nociceptive pain, caused by tissue damage, and neuropathic pain, caused by nervous system dysfunction. Understanding the type of pain is crucial for proper assessment and treatment.


Assessment of Pain:


Physiotherapists employ various methods to assess a patient's pain and its underlying causes. These assessments are essential for developing a personalized treatment plan. Common assessment techniques include:

  1. Physical Examination: A thorough physical examination helps identify the source of pain and assess physical limitations. Range of motion, muscle strength, and posture are evaluated.

  2. Patient History: Understanding the patient's medical history and pain-related details can provide valuable insights into the nature and potential causes of the pain.

  3. Diagnostic Tests: Physiotherapists may request imaging, such as X-rays or MRIs, to visualize structural issues like fractures, disc herniations, or joint problems.

  4. Functional Assessment: To understand how pain affects daily activities, physiotherapists may ask patients to perform specific movements and tasks.


Treatment Approaches:


Once the source and nature of pain are established, physiotherapists employ a range of evidence-based treatments. These are tailored to the individual and their specific condition. Common physiotherapy treatments for pain include:


  1. Manual Therapy: Physiotherapists use their hands to manipulate soft tissues, joints, and muscles, aiming to improve mobility and reduce pain.

  2. Exercise Therapy: Customized exercise programs help strengthen muscles, improve flexibility, and enhance overall function. These exercises can alleviate pain and prevent its recurrence.

  3. Modalities: Physiotherapists may use therapeutic modalities like heat, cold, ultrasound, and electrical stimulation to reduce pain and promote healing.

  4. Education and Lifestyle Advice: Patients are educated about their condition, proper body mechanics, and strategies to prevent future pain episodes.

  5. Ergonomic Recommendations: For individuals with work-related pain, physiotherapists provide ergonomic advice to optimize their workspace and reduce strain.


The Science Behind Pain Relief:

Physiotherapy treatments are rooted in scientific principles.

  1. Pain Gate Control Theory: This theory suggests that non-painful input can "close the gate" to painful input in the spinal cord, reducing the perception of pain. Physiotherapy interventions like electrical stimulation or massage can activate this gate control mechanism.

  2. Neuromuscular Re-education: Physiotherapists help patients retrain their muscles and nervous system to improve coordination and function, reducing pain and enhancing mobility.

  3. Tissue Healing: Understanding the stages of tissue healing is crucial for determining the appropriate time to introduce specific treatments. Physiotherapists adjust their interventions based on the current stage of tissue healing.
